How to read the library
Readers can move among three depths without having to traverse the same amount of detail.
- Core essay: the complete AIOS thesis in one continuous argument.
- Concept pages: the mechanisms and implications developed in detail, with selective research connections.
- Research library: research briefs and full memos for readers who want methods, counterevidence, and source-level descent.
The briefs connect evidence directly to the chapters that own each AIOS mechanism. The full memos preserve source-level depth and enable verification without turning the core essay into a literature review.
The library does not define AIOS. The governing architecture is developed in the AIOS Intelligence System Core Thesis. Research enters the public overview only when it clarifies a mechanism, establishes a relevant boundary, distinguishes AIOS from neighboring work, or supplies a meaningful test.
